Actor denies using voodoo to grow career

The actor swore in front of a crowd of graduating students that he has never been involved in the use of magic, especially when it concerns his acting career.

 

In a news report published by Punch News on Saturday, September 3, 2016, the actor denied the story, adding that his belief in God had been the reason for his success.

“I never knew I would be successful as an actor; my belief has always been that God should elevate me in my endeavours. I always prayed that God should make me a successful person."

“Some people say that I used voodoo or metaphysical powers to be successful. I hear when they say such but I tell everyone that I can never do such."

To clear any doubt about his sincerity concerning the voodoo rumour, the actor swore in front of a crowd at a graduation ceremony held at his acting institute, Odunlade Adekola Drama and Film Production, Abeokuta.

"During the graduation of my students last year, I addressed this issue because it was during that time people were peddling rumours of my demise."

"When the rumour of my death hit town, some people said that I did ‘jazz’ to be successful. That was why during the graduation of my students last year, I said it in public that if I had ever thought of doing ‘jazz’ to succeed God should make me lose everything I had ever worked for."

“I hear these comments but they do not move me at all. I am a writer, director, producer and an actor. It is normal for people to talk but it has never upset me.”

According to the actor, his acting career took shape when he was just a child.

A friend of his had recommended him to a movie producer, who later introduced him to acting group. This was how he rose to become one of Nigeria's top actors.
